Section 50

In disposing of land under the provisions of this Code, the Director-General shall have the power to dispose of it by sale or hire-purchase according to the rules and procedures specified in Ministerial Regulations and shall have the power to levy a fee of not more than five per cent of the sale price. If unable to dispose of the land within two years the Director-General with the approval of the Minister shall have the power to sell on installments within ten years.

The exercise of the power under the provisions of the first paragraph, the Director-General may divide up the land into plots for disposal as he thinks fit.

Section 51

In case where the Director-General uses his power to dispose of land under this Code, persons with rights in the land to be disposed of shall agree with the competent authority as to which plot or part of the land shall be disposed of. If they are unable to agree, the matter shall be submitted to the Commission for decision.

Section 52

In case the Director-General sees fit to exercise his power to dispose of land, the competent authority shall notify persons with right in land not less than thirty days in advance. After the expiration of the said period, the competent authority shall come to an agreement with persons having rights in the land as to its price. If they are unable to agree on the price of the land, the provisions governing valuation of immovable properties by arbitration under the law on expropriation of immovable properties shall apply mutatis mutandis.

The land price which may be agreed on or fixed by arbitration shall reflect the market price current on the day the competent authority notifies persons with rights in land that the Director-General will use the power of disposal.

Section 53

From the day the competent authority gives notice under Section 52 the Director-General shall have the right of possession to the land and persons having rights in land including tenants, occupants and others shall vacate the land within one year. Any lease of that plot of land shall cease to have effect on the day the competent authority informs persons having rights in land that the Director-General will use the power of disposal.

Section 54

The Director-General, in disposing of any person's land the terms of this Code through hire purchase or on installment sale, shall pay the purchase price to the person entitled thereto in part payments to be completed within the following periods:

  1. In disposals under Section 39, installments shall be paid within five years.
  2. In disposals under other Section, installments shall be paid within ten years. In such payment by installments, interest shall be paid by the purchase or hire-purchaser of the land to the persons, who formerly had rights in the land at the rate of three per year.

Section 55

In the event of a sale or hire-purchase of land under Section 50, if the purchaser or hire- purchaser does not abide by the conditions in the contract of sale or hire-purchaser does not abide by the conditions in the contract of sale or hire-purchase, as the case may be, the Director-General shall have the power to repossess the land. In such case, rights in the land shall vest in the Land Department in the day on which the purchaser or hire- purchaser learns or should learn of the repossession.
